(1)Any rights to or in relation to mines or minerals on or under a holding which on a sale by agreement under the Land Purchase Acts would be reserved to the Commission pursuant to section thirteen of the Act of 1903, shall, subject to section ninety-nine of the said Act, and save as hereinafter provided, vest in the Commission on the vesting of the holding in them by virtue of this Part of this Act, and shall be reserved to the Commission on the resale of the holding without the necessity of any express reservation.
(2)If, on an application made by the owner within the prescribed time and in the prescribed manner, the Commission is satisfied that any such rights possess a substantial value, whether actual or potential, and that although they are not being exercised at the time of the application there is a reasonable prospect of mines or minerals to which they relate being worked or developed within twenty years thereafter, they may make an order directing that all or any of the rights as therein specified shall to the extent therein mentioned be excepted on the vesting of the holding in the Commission and they shall be so excepted accordingly, and shall not be affected by such vesting. If the Commission refuse to make an order under this section an appeal shall lie to the Court of Appeal in Northern Ireland, whose decision shall be final.
(3)Subsection (4) of section thirteen of the Act of 1903 shall apply as respects any rights excepted under this section in like manner as it applies as respects rights reserved under that section.
